Basic Concepts of Air Intake Manifolds

An air intake manifold is a part of the engine that distributes air, mixed with fuel, into the cylinders of an internal combustion engine. Its function is to evenly distribute the air-fuel mixture to each cylinder, which contributes to the overall performance and efficiency of the engine. The design and material of the manifold can affect the engine’s power output, fuel efficiency, and emissions 1.

Conclusion

The Cummins 5295476 Air Intake Manifold is a critical component in the engine’s air induction system, facilitating the smooth and efficient introduction of air into the engine. This manifold is engineered to distribute the incoming air evenly across the engine’s cylinders, ensuring optimal combustion efficiency. When integrated with the engine, it connects to the throttle body at one end, allowing controlled airflow into the system. It then branches out into multiple runners, each leading to an individual cylinder. This design minimizes air turbulence and maximizes airflow velocity, contributing to enhanced engine performance. The manifold also interfaces with the engine control unit (ECU), which monitors and adjusts the air-fuel mixture for each cylinder. This interaction ensures that the engine operates within its optimal parameters, balancing power output with fuel efficiency and emissions control. Furthermore, the Air Intake Manifold is often equipped with temperature sensors that provide the ECU with real-time data on the incoming air’s temperature. This information is vital for the ECU to make precise adjustments to the fuel injection timing and quantity, thereby maintaining the engine’s performance under varying operating conditions.
